Address 0 DOGE

DEbFxnKTAaEP6DVUvzSBKE8EDA7uX3DdN1

Confirmed

Total Received462.66688852 DOGE
Total Sent462.66688852 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

Fee: 1 DOGE
4563735 Confirmations50350.77207236 DOGE
DEbFxnKTAaEP6DVUvzSBKE8EDA7uX3DdN1462.66688852 DOGE
DJTEJkdmE4mNYCJdk2ooGv11WNJvD3WS782000 DOGE
Fee: 1 DOGE
4563759 Confirmations2462.66688852 DOGE